Roxatidine (150 mg, 312 patients) was compared with ranitidine (300 mg, 308 patients) in a randomized, double-blind, parallel-group, 6-week therapeutic study for the treatment of patients with uncomplicated, benign gastric ulcer disease. The study end points (verified by using endoscopy results) were fully healed ulcers at 4 or 6 weeks. The results of roxatidine therapy were comparable to those of ranitidine therapy: healing rates of 52% and 54% at week 4 and 77% and 76% at week 6 were recorded for roxatidine and ranitidine, respectively. The drugs produced comparable reductions in ulcer diameters and decreases in
abdominal pain
. Adverse events associated with both roxatidine (27%) and ranitidine (28%) were headache, diarrhea, and
dizziness
; rash was associated in 6 of 8 cases and in only 1 case with roxatidine. In this trial, roxatidine 150 mg once daily was as efficacious and safe as ranitidine 300 mg once daily for treatment of patients with uncomplicated, benign gastric ulcer disease.

Mefloquine is an orally administered blood schizontocide. Initial dose-finding and comparative studies performed between 1977 and 1989 demonstrated efficacy of mefloquine as prophylaxis in nonimmune individuals and in the suppression and treatment of malaria in adults and children caused by multidrug-resistant Plasmodium falciparum. It was also effective against P. vivax infection, while data concerning the treatment of P. ovale and P. malariae infections were limited. In an attempt to delay the emergence of resistance to this promising antimalarial agent, mefloquine was combined with sulfadoxine and pyrimethamine. Although initial clinical trials indicated that this regimen was effective in preventing and treating falciparum malaria, recent treatment failures, the potential for severe dermatological reactions and lack of therapeutic advantage over mefloquine alone has prompted the World Health Organization to recommended that the combination be no longer used for treatment or prophylaxis of malaria. Mefloquine is generally well tolerated in both adults and children, with nausea, vomiting, diarrhoea, headache,
dizziness
, rash, pruritus and
abdominal pain
being the most common adverse effects, although it is difficult to distinguish between disease- and treatment-related events. The incidence of these adverse effects is similar to or lower than those observed with other antimalarial agents. Cardiovascular changes, such as bradycardia, occasionally occur. The most notable adverse effects associated with mefloquine are neuropsychiatric disturbances; precipitation of such events should be closely monitored and requires termination of prophylaxis or therapy. The eventual emergence of resistance to mefloquine, as with many other antimalarial agents, was inevitable. Mefloquine resistance is established in certain areas of Thailand and may be becoming a growing problem in other regions of the world. In order to preserve the efficacy of mefloquine in non-resistant areas, this useful agent should be used with care and only prescribed for prophylaxis in travellers and treatment in areas of multidrug-resistant plasmodia. Future options to combat mefloquine resistance may include the combination of mefloquine with other antimalarial agents such as qinghaosu derivatives. Thus, with cautious use and possible combination with other agents, mefloquine is likely to remain an important treatment option for falciparum malaria, a widespread parasitic disease for which an increasing number of drugs have proved inadequate.

Because the symptomatic treatments for multiple sclerosis (MS) are limited, new approaches have been sought. Anatomical studies of MS lesions show a relative preservation of axons, and clinical studies suggest that some of the neurological impairment in patients with MS is physiological. Electrophysiological studies suggest that demyelination exposes axonal potassium channels that decrease action-potential duration and amplitude, hindering action-potential propagation. Potassium channel blockers, including aminopyridines, have been shown to improve nerve conduction in experimentally demyelinated nerves. Two potassium channel blockers, 4-aminopyridine (AP) and 3,4 diaminopyridine (DAP) have been tested in patients with MS. Preliminary studies of AP demonstrated benefit in many temperature-sensitive patients with MS, and improvement of function was found in a large randomized double-blind, placebo-controlled crossover trial of 3 months of oral treatment in 68 patients with MS. An open-label trial of DAP showed improvement in some deficits, and a double-blind placebo-controlled trial showed significant improvements in prospectively defined neurological deficits. A crossover comparison of the two agents suggested that AP produces more central nervous system side effects (
dizziness
and confusion), whereas DAP produces more peripheral side effects (paresthesias and
abdominal pain
). Both agents have rarely caused seizures. These studies suggest that aminopyridines may provide a new approach to the symptomatic treatment of MS.

Omeprazole has been marketed in France since 1989, for the healing of peptic ulcers, erosive reflux esophagitis and the Zollinger Ellison syndrome. It is a proton pump inhibitor which inhibits the acid secretion in the stomach. In the majority of the clinical trials, omeprazole has been found to be well tolerated: headache,
dizziness
, skin rash, constipation have just been noted. Since September 1989, 143 adverse reactions have been reported to pharmacovigilance centres and Astra France: 37 neurological and psychiatric side effects, especially confusion in patients with hepatic diseases and/or advanced age; 35 cutaneous reactions, generally rash and urticaria; 22 hematological effects: leucopenia and agranulocytosis have been reported but the relation with omeprazole is very uncertain; 10 gastrointestinal effects, generally diarrhoea, nausea, vomiting and
abdominal pain
; 8 hepatic disorders, especially moderate elevation of aminotransferases. This study confirms the safety of this drug, during short treatment; the frequency of notified adverse effects is about 1/12 200 treatments of 4 weeks. The ministry of health, has decided, in november 1991, to inform the prescribers of this potential toxicity of omeprazole, particularly, of the risk of confusion, hepatotoxicity and leucopenia.

We performed a prospective randomized trial in a predominantly outpatient colonoscopy population to see how preparation with oral sodium phosphate solution compares with polyethylene glycol-electrolyte lavage in terms of the quality of colon cleansing, ease of preparation, and gastrointestinal intolerance. Before colonoscopy, a nurse administered a questionnaire to the patient to assess how well the preparation was tolerated (scale from 1 to 5:1 = easy, to 5 = unable to finish) and about the presence of four symptoms:
abdominal pain
, nausea, vomiting, and
dizziness
. The quality of colon cleansing was graded by the attending gastroenterologist, who was unaware of how the patient was prepared or tolerated the preparation (1 = excellent, 2 = good, 3 = fair, 4 = poor). The overall quality of bowel preparation with polyethylene glycol lavage was slightly better than with sodium phosphate (mean score, 1.93 vs 2.07); however, the difference was not statistically different. No statistical difference was seen in the frequency of patients with poor preparations (14.2% for sodium phosphate, 9.6% for polyethylene glycol lavage). Patients found preparation with sodium phosphate to be somewhat easier than polyethylene glycol lavage (mean score, 2.07 vs 2.41; p = 0.05). No difference was seen in the incidence of
abdominal pain
, nausea, or vomiting.
Dizziness
was more common with sodium phosphate but was mild and not believed to be clinically important. We conclude that the quality of colon cleansing is similar with polyethylene glycol lavage and oral sodium phosphate solution, with satisfactory preparation seen in 85% to 90% of patients. Patients found preparation with sodium phosphate to be slightly easier to tolerate.(ABSTRACT TRUNCATED AT 250 WORDS)

Thirty-three female patients suffering from acute uncomplicated falciparum malaria were treated with intramuscular artemether for 5 days during May-October 1990. Fourteen patients received 160 mg as an initial dose, followed by 80 mg daily for 4 days. Nineteen patients with low body weight (mean weight of 36.5 kg) were given artemether at 3.2/kg as a loading dose and followed by 1.6 mg/kg/dose for another 4 days. The geometric mean of parasitemia was 17,378/microliters (range 640-234,720). The mean fever (FCT) and parasite clearance time (PCT) were 41.8 and 49.4 hours, respectively. Two patients had probable intercurrent infection with FCT of over 7 days. Thirty-one patients had completed the 28-day follow-up. The cure rate was 90.3% (28/31). Three patients had RI type of response. Mild and transient adverse effects were experienced in eleven patients; these consisted of pain at the injection sites, vomiting,
dizziness
,
abdominal pain
, palpitation and diarrhea. These symptoms may in part be due to symptom complex of malaria. The MIC of chloroquine, quinine, quinidine and mefloquine was performed in all patients but only 25 isolates were successfully cultured and tested. The MIC of all tested drugs were shown to be higher than that of previous studies, suggesting that there is a rapid increase of mefloquine resistant strains of falciparum malaria. In conclusion, artemether proves to be effective against multiple drug resistant falciparum malaria (including mefloquine resistant strains) and can be considered as an alternative antimalarial to mefloquine. The drug was well tolerated in female patients with mild and transient side-effects.(ABSTRACT TRUNCATED AT 250 WORDS)

A review was conducted of the safety and tolerability of fluvoxamine in 54 worldwide marketing studies that enrolled 24,624 patients, the majority of whom were treated with fluvoxamine in uncontrolled studies in depression. In accordance with the general epidemiologic distribution of depressive disorder, female patients and patients aged between 30 and 50 years predominated. The majority of patients were treated for 6 weeks, the most frequent, or modal, total daily dose being 100 mg. Overall, 57.4% of the patients exposed to fluvoxamine did not have any adverse experiences. The greatest proportion of adverse experiences, as defined using COSTART body systems, affected the digestive system (24.1%), the nervous system (23.7%), and the body as a whole (15.3%). The only adverse experience with an incidence greater than 10% was nausea (15.7%); somnolence (6.9%) and asthenia (6.2%) were the next most frequent adverse experiences. Notably, the rates of agitation and anxiety were only 1.4% and 1.3%, respectively. The incidences of adverse experiences generally increased with age and were slightly higher in females than in males. In total, 15.1% of patients discontinued treatment prematurely as a result of adverse experiences, principally nausea,
dizziness
, vomiting, somnolence,
abdominal pain
, and headache. The overall incidence of serious adverse events in association with fluvoxamine treatment was 2.5% when U.S. Food and Drug Administration criteria and the most conservative approach, without causality judgments, were used.(ABSTRACT TRUNCATED AT 250 WORDS)

This is the first report on human toxicosis in China caused by moldy rice contaminated with Fusarium and T-2 toxin due to heavy rainfall during rice harvest season. One hundred and sixty-five persons ate the moldy rice and ninety-seven persons fall ill of food poisoning. The incidence was 58.8% and latent period was 10-30 min. The chief symptoms were nausea,
dizziness
, vomiting, chills, abdominal distension,
abdominal pain
, thoracic stuffiness and diarrhea. The fungi isolated from the moldy rice were predominantly Fusarium heterosporum (F. heterosporum) and F. graminearum. T-2 toxin was found in these moldy rice and the highest level was 420 ppb. The chief causative agent of intoxication was T-2 toxin.

A total of 217 patients with essential hypertension were enrolled by 25 Canadian centers in this double-blind, parallel study to compare the efficacy and safety of enalapril administered alone or in combination with hydrochlorothiazide. After a 4-week placebo period, patients were given 10 mg of enalapril for 2 weeks. At the end of the 2 weeks of therapy, patients were maintained on the same dose of enalapril, titrated to a higher dose of enalapril, or received combination therapy with hydrochlorothiazide if their diastolic blood pressure remained > 90 mmHg. Patients in group 1 received enalapril 10 mg or 20 mg and those in group 2 received enalapril 10 mg alone or combined with hydrochlorothiazide 25 mg. The maintenance phase lasted 8 weeks. A standard mercury sphygmomanometer was used to measure blood pressure at each visit. The mean decrease in supine diastolic blood pressure (SDBP) was 16 mmHg in groups 1 and 2; the mean decrease in supine systolic blood pressure (SSBP) was 19 mmHg in group 1 and 20 mmHg in group 2. Eighty percent of the patients in group 1 and 81% of those in group 2 had an SDBP < or = 90 mmHg at the final visit. To achieve this control, 67% of the patients received enalapril 10 mg and 33% received enalapril 20 mg in group 1. In group 2, 70% of the patients received enalapril 10 mg and 30% received enalapril 10 mg plus hydrochlorothiazide 25 mg. Eighteen patients in group 1 and 17 patients in group 2 experienced one or more minor adverse events. The most frequently reported adverse events were headache, asthenia,
abdominal pain
, nausea, and
dizziness
. No major adverse events were observed. We conclude that enalapril used alone reduces blood pressure in the majority of patients with mild to moderate essential hypertension. When blood pressure is not controlled by enalapril alone, hydrochlorothiazide can safely be added to the regimen.

1. The pharmacokinetics and tolerance of DV-7751a were investigated in healthy male Caucasian volunteers after single oral doses (100, 200, 400 and 800 mg). 2. DV-7751a was rapidly absorbed in the fasted state. The mean maximum concentration in plasma (Cmax) ranged from 0.27 to 1.98 micrograms/ml for the 100-800-mg dose and the mean time to reach Cmax (tmax) ranged from 1.1 to 1.9 h. The terminal half-life ranged from 8.75 to 10.0 h. A good linear correlation (r = 0.974) was found between doses from 100 to 800 mg and the resulting area under the concentration-time curve (AUC). The plasma protein binding of the drug was in the range of 57-65%. 3. Within 48 h, the cumulative urinary excretion of unchanged drug amounted to 22.0-26.8% of the dose administered. Faecal recovery of the drug up to 72 h after the 400-mg dose was about 12% of the dose given. 4. Adverse events thought to be possibly related to the drug included headache, rash, leg cramp, diarrhoea,
abdominal pain
, CNS depression and
dizziness
. DV-7751a, however, was well tolerated with no serious adverse events at any doses and all subjects completed the study. No drug crystals were observed in the urine.
